Basic Information
| Product Name | 7-[(Trimethylsilyl)Oxy]Androst-4-Ene-3,17-Dione Bis(o-Methyloxime) |
| CAS No. | 69833-73-4 |
| Molecular Formula | C24H40N2O3Si |
| Molecular Weight | 432.68 g/mol |
| Synonyms | Androst-4-ene-3,17-dione, 7-[(trimethylsilyl)oxy]-, bis(O-methyloxime); 7-TMS-O-Androst-4-ene-3,17-dione bis-O-methyloxime; 7-(Trimethylsiloxy)androst-4-ene-3,17-dione dioxime O,O'-dimethyl ether; 69833-73-4; 7-Trimethylsilyloxyandrost-4-ene-3,17-dione bis(O-methyloxime); Steroid TMS-O-methyloxime derivative |
